sql >> データベース >  >> Database Tools >> phpMyAdmin

インポートcsvの日付が0000-00-00に変更されます

    str_to_dateを使用して日付をmysql形式に調整する必要があります

    以下のようなものが機能するはずです。

    LOAD DATA INFILE 'filename.csv' INTO TABLE table_name 
    FIELDS TERMINATED BY ',' ENCLOSED BY '"' 
    LINES TERMINATED BY '\n' IGNORE 1 LINES 
    (@myDate,col2,col3,col4,col5,col6,col7,@dummy_variable)
    Set dummy_variable = 0, Date = str_to_date(@myDate,'%d/%m/%Y')
    



    1. SQL ServerManagementStudio-複数のデータベースで名前でストアドプロシージャを検索する

    2. SQL選択文字列が機能しない

    3. phpmyadminからデータベースをインポートできません

    4. Mysql / PHPMyAdminでの1138の999.99の値